How they compare
Eritrea currently reports 19.0% against 6.2% in Least developed countries, a difference of 12.8%.
That makes Eritrea's figure about 3.1 times Least developed countries's.
The two have swapped places 3 times across 19 shared years of data; in 1993 it was Least developed countries ahead.
Eritrea ranks 11th and Least developed countries ranks 10th of 184 countries.
Least developed countries has averaged higher in every one of the 3 decades both report.

About this data
Natural resource depletion is the sum of net forest depletion, energy depletion, and mineral depletion. Net forest depletion is unit resource rents times the excess of roundwood harvest over natural growth. Energy depletion is the ratio of the value of the stock of energy resources to the remaining reserve lifetime (capped at 25 years). It covers coal, crude oil, and natural gas. Mineral depletion is the ratio of the value of the stock of mineral resources to the remaining reserve lifetime (capped at 25 years). It covers tin, gold, lead, zinc, iron, copper, nickel, silver, bauxite, and phosphate. This indicator is expressed as a percentage of Gross National Income (GNI) which is the total income earned by all residents within an economic territory during an accounting period. It is equal to gross domestic product plus earned income receivable from abroad minus earned income payable abroad.
